云服务器卡顿现象可能由多种因素引起,以下是具体分析:
网络问题
1、网络延迟:网络延迟是指数据从源头到目的地所需的时间,高延迟会导致数据传输变慢,从而影响云服务器的响应速度和处理效率。
2、带宽不足:带宽是网络中可用于传输数据的最大容量,如果云服务器的带宽不足以支持其工作负载,那么数据传输将受到限制,导致卡顿现象。
3、丢包率:在网络传输过程中,数据包可能会丢失或错误,导致需要重新传输,这会增加延迟并降低性能,高丢包率会严重影响云服务器的稳定性。
4、网络拥堵:在高峰时段,大量用户同时访问云服务,可能会导致网络拥堵,进一步加剧延迟和卡顿现象。
硬件资源限制
1、CPU负载过高:当云服务器的CPU负载持续处于高水平时,处理能力受限,无法及时完成计算任务,导致系统响应变慢。
2、内存不足:内存是计算机用于存储正在运行的程序和数据的空间,内存不足会导致操作系统频繁使用虚拟内存(硬盘空间),从而大幅降低数据处理速度。
3、磁盘I/O瓶颈:磁盘输入/输出操作的速度直接影响数据读写效率,如果磁盘I/O速度慢,会导致数据存取延迟,进而影响整体性能。
4、硬件老化:随着时间的推移,硬件设备可能会出现老化,性能下降,这也是导致云服务器卡顿的潜在原因之一。
软件配置问题
1、应用程序配置不当:应用程序的配置错误或不合理可能导致资源浪费,如数据库连接过多、缓存设置不当等,都会影响性能。
2、软件冲突:在云服务器上安装的多个软件之间可能存在冲突,消耗过多资源,影响系统稳定性和性能。
3、过时的软件:使用过时的软件版本可能会存在已知的性能问题或安全漏洞,更新到最新版本可以解决这些问题。
4、病毒和恶意软件:病毒或恶意软件的存在会占用系统资源,干扰正常操作,导致性能下降和卡顿现象。
5、不适当的应用程序:某些应用程序可能不适合在云环境中运行,或者没有针对云环境进行优化,这也可能导致性能问题。
其他因素
1、并发请求过多:面对大量的并发请求,单个云服务器可能难以处理,导致响应时间延长和系统卡顿。
2、安全防护机制:为了保护数据安全,云服务提供商可能会实施各种安全措施,如防火墙、入侵检测系统等,这些措施虽然提高了安全性,但也可能增加处理负担,影响性能。
3、服务商策略:云服务商的策略和技术限制也可能影响云服务器的配置和性能,虚拟化技术和数据中心的硬件限制可能导致无法提供更高的资源配置。
云服务器卡顿是一个复杂的问题,涉及多个方面的因素,通过综合分析和针对性地采取措施,可以有效地解决或减轻卡顿现象,提升云服务器的性能和用户体验。
云服务器卡顿的原因可能涉及多个方面,以下是一些常见的原因,以表格形式呈现:
原因分类 | 具体原因 | 可能的解决方法 |
资源限制 | 1. CPU 资源不足 | 1. 增加CPU核心数或升级CPU型号 |
2. 内存不足 | 1. 增加内存容量 | |
3. 硬盘IO瓶颈 | 1. 升级到SSD硬盘 | |
4. 网络带宽限制 | 1. 增加网络带宽 | |
系统问题 | 1. 系统资源占用过高 | 1. 优化系统配置,关闭不必要的后台服务 |
2. 系统文件损坏 | 1. 重装操作系统,修复损坏的系统文件 | |
3. 系统更新问题 | 1. 检查并安装系统更新 | |
应用问题 | 1. 应用程序设计缺陷 | 1. 优化应用程序代码,减少资源消耗 |
2. 应用程序并发处理不当 | 1. 优化并发处理机制,增加线程或进程数量 | |
3. 数据库性能问题 | 1. 优化数据库查询,增加索引,升级数据库版本 | |
网络问题 | 1. 网络延迟或丢包率高 | 1. 优化网络配置,检查网络设备状态 |
2. 网络攻击或恶意流量 | 1. 部署防火墙和入侵检测系统,限制恶意流量 | |
硬件故障 | 1. 服务器硬件故障(如CPU、内存、硬盘故障) | 1. 检查硬件设备,进行维修或更换 |
2. 电源问题 | 1. 检查电源设备,确保电源稳定 | |
虚拟化问题 | 1. 虚拟机资源分配不当 | 1. 重新分配虚拟机资源,确保每个虚拟机都有足够的资源分配 |
2. 虚拟化软件问题 | 1. 更新虚拟化软件,修复已知问题 |
上述原因可能存在交叉,实际排查时需要综合考虑多种因素,在解决卡顿问题时,通常需要逐步排查,从最可能的原因开始,逐步排除。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1161428.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复